Casa Quickie:  Making Small Spaces Seem Bigger One way to make your small pad seem visually expansive is by exercising a light touch with your color scheme. If you use lighter textiles for upholstery, blond wood for large furniture pieces, and a lighter color palette for your walls, your small space will gain some visual square footage.
